Dad, Mum and I have been working hard on new stables for the ponies! I'm very proud at how they turned out and I just have to share some pics with you all!

The actual shelter was built in 2008 for my brother as bird aviaries. Then we stripped it back when my brother stopped breeding birds and made them an open horse shelter. They were then made into separate enclosed stalls for the horses, but it we made them on budget with just materials we had laying around, so they were always getting broken and eventually with all the 'quick fixes' they started to look very tacky. I decided that now I have a job, it was time to properly fix them up.

There is 3 boxes, 2 small ones for Kevin and Willow and 1 large one for Specter. We used all new materials, dad and I built all the walls, we concreted the 2 smaller boxes and the large box has sand. Mum welded up all the gates, hinges and latches and I did all the painting and oiling. It was a team effort  :D

We have used gas bottle holders as water trough mounts and the feeders are temporary- just a bucket tied with rope but I'm yet to put in the proper ones. I've used saw dust as the bedding in the small boxes, I think Willow is enjoying it because she likes to stand on 'padded' ground as shes getting old.

I have still got to finish painting Specter's box but other than that they are all finished!  ;D
